Rukidi IV Of Tooro Date Of Birth: Historical Verification And Modern Significance
The historical records regarding the Rukidi IV of Tooro date of birth remain a focal point of scholarly interest as the Tooro Kingdom continues to modernize its archival systems in 2026. While King Oyo Nyimba Kabamba Iguru Rukidi IV ascended to the throne in 1995, the precise verification of his developmental timeline and the symbolic weight of his birth date—April 16, 1992—continue to define the narrative of Africa’s youngest reigning monarch.
| Quick Fact | Detail |
|---|---|
| Monarch Name | Rukidi IV (King Oyo Nyimba Kabamba Iguru) |
| Date of Birth | April 16, 1992 |
| Place of Birth | Fort Portal, Uganda |
| Kingdom | Tooro Kingdom |
| Ascension Date | September 12, 1995 |
| Current Status | Reigning Monarch (34 years old) |
